Research Focus ๐Ÿ”ฌ

Saima Butt’s research interests are deeply rooted in intellectual property rights, particularly within developing countries. Her doctoral dissertation, titled โ€œPatent Ordinance 2000 and Its Effects on Access to Medicines: A Comparative Study in the Light of TRIPS Agreement and Doha Declarationโ€, showcases her commitment to addressing critical issues affecting global health and medicine accessibility. Her LLM thesis, โ€œImpediments in the Implementation of Intellectual Property Rights in Developing Countriesโ€, further highlights her dedication to improving legal frameworks in less developed regions. Her published research paper, โ€œIntellectual Property Rights and Right to Health: An International Perspectiveโ€, underscores her scholarly contributions to international legal discourse. ๐Ÿ†

๐Ÿ“š Academic and Professional Background

๐ŸŽ“ Professor at Dalian Maritime University, doctoral supervisor. Member of the China Institute of Navigation ๐Ÿšข, Researcher at the China Shipping 50 Forum ๐Ÿ›ณ๏ธ, and Special Researcher at the China Maritime Think Tank ๐Ÿข. Graduated with a doctorate from Jilin University ๐ŸŽ“, with a postdoctoral fellowship at Dalian University of Technology ๐Ÿซ, and a visiting scholar at University College London (UCL) ๐ŸŒ. Has over 20 years of frontline teaching and research experience ๐Ÿ“š, mainly focusing on ship traffic organization optimization โš“, intelligent autonomous navigation decision-making and control ๐Ÿค–, and maritime big data-assisted decision-making ๐Ÿ“Š.

Xinyu Zhang has an impressive academic and professional portfolio. ๐Ÿ“š He has completed or is currently engaged in 14 research projects and has a remarkable H-Index of 18 in the Web of Science. ๐ŸŒŸ In consultancy and industry projects, he has contributed to 16 research endeavors. He has authored two books with ISBNs: The Encyclopedia of China (Third Edition), Volume on Transportation, Chapter on Waterway Transportation, Section on Intelligent Water Transportation (9787520208581), and Digital Construction and Ecological Development (9787112283651). Additionally, he has published 24 patents and has 21 more under process. ๐Ÿ… Mr. Zhang has also published over 50 articles in SCI-indexed journals. ๐Ÿ“–
